Title: Large dead zone in middle of pitch wheel
Post by: BobTheDog on January 28, 2017, 10:19:50 pm
Hi Guys,

My pitch wheel has got a large dead zone in the middle, makes it impossible to do vibrato.

Is this normal?

I think there is intentional deadzone on the dual function FM dials so that you can activate in slots 13-16 of the matrix, but that wouldn't make sense on the pitch wheel.  I will experiment when I get home and report back.

Yes, same here.  Hard to be precise, but it feels like about 1cm in each direction before anything starts happening.
